Umbrella and awning handle fit nicely in where the chairs store in rear boot
 
I keep a small umbrella above the glove box in the front, but I have a large umbrella that's resting on top of the folded comfort mattress behind the bench seat. I just have to release and bring the bench seat-back forward a bit to reach it:
